Premises : SP Group, Birmingham & Redditch
Size: 200,000 sq ft
Timescale: 16 weeks
Value: £380,000.00
Scope of Works
Problem:
Due to a rapidly expanding print business, space was running out across two sites. They required additional office and welfare facilities. There was also the need to consolidate archive and WIP storage across the two sites.
Solution:
The factory and offices remained fully functional during all stages of the works and a phased handover of areas planned for weekends ensured minimum disruption to customer service and production.
There were various designs for office and works partitioning systems.
The use of solid, single and double-glazed fully demountable partitioning, some with integral blinds were used. Also works were carried out to provide suspended ceilings, fire protection, floor coverings, electrics and air conditioning.
New and refurbished cloakrooms, changing facilities, canteen and toilets were provided These areas were built primarily using the same materials as the offices, with the inclusion of some modular and double skin steel partitioning, canteen table and chairs and vinyl floor coverings.
We were also responsible for various building works including double glazed windows. We coordinated all necessary actions with the fire officer and building control. All works also in compliance with the required CDM regulations.
